News summary

Indianapolis Colts General Manager Chris Ballard remains steadfast in his team-building approach as he enters his eighth season despite only securing one playoff win and no AFC South titles. Ballard faces significant pressure and scrutiny after three consecutive seasons without making the playoffs. He acknowledges the franchise's shortcomings but continues to express strong belief in his methods, stating that he won't waver even if it costs him his job. The Colts hope their 2023 first-round pick, quarterback Anthony Richardson, can lead them to a successful season following his return from a shoulder injury. Despite calls for major changes, Ballard has resisted making high-profile acquisitions, maintaining his commitment to his foundational principles.
